To find inmate records in Harnett County, North Carolina, you have several options. Online, you can visit the Harnett County Sheriff’s Office website, which typically provides an inmate inquiry or jail roster section allowing you to search for current detainees using names or booking dates (https://www.harnettsheriff.com/). For more detailed records or past inmate information, you may submit a public records request through their online forms or by contacting the Sheriff's Office directly. Offline, you can visit or call the Harnett County Sheriff’s Office located at 175 Bain Street, Lillington, NC 27546 (phone: 910-893-9111). Here, staff can assist you with inmate information requests or guide you to appropriate public resources. Additionally, court-related inmate records can sometimes be accessed through the Harnett County Clerk of Court’s Office at the Harnett County Courthouse. Always have relevant details such as the inmate’s full name or date of birth to help streamline your search.
How to Find an Inmate in Harnett County, NC
Inmate records for Harnett County, NC can be accessed online, but the appropriate search tool depends on whether the person is held locally, at the state level, or in federal custody. Below is a guide to finding inmate information using the most relevant resources for each type of facility.
| Search Tool | Records Available | Access Method | Key Details |
|---|---|---|---|
| Harnett County Sheriff's Office/Jail | Local jail inmates | Harnett County Inmate Inquiry Or call (910) 893-0257 | Best for anyone recently arrested or held in Harnett County Detention Center at 175 Bain St, Lillington, NC 27546 |
| North Carolina DOC Inmate Locator | State prison inmates | NC Department of Adult Correction Offender Search | For individuals sentenced to state prisons anywhere in North Carolina |
| VINE Inmate Search | Custody status & notifications | VINElink NC | Register for alerts about changes in inmate custody status statewide, including local and regional jails |
| Federal BOP Locator | Federal prisoners | BOP Inmate Locator | No federal prison in Harnett County. NC federal inmates usually housed at FCC Butner or FCI Bennettsville, SC |
| In-Person Records Request | Local inmate or arrest records | Visit Harnett County Sheriff's Office, 175 Bain St, Lillington, NC 27546 Phone: (910) 893-0257 | Bring photo ID; office hours are Mon–Fri 8am–5pm. Useful for official records or documents not found online |
Booking Process & Common Charges in Harnett County
After an arrest in Harnett County, individuals are typically transported to the jail, fingerprinted, photographed, medically screened, and assigned housing; the entire process generally takes 4–8 hours. Below is an overview of the most common charge categories and their typical processing details in Harnett County.
| Charge Category | Common Examples | Frequency | Typical Hold Duration |
|---|---|---|---|
| DUI / Traffic | DWI, driving without license | High | 12–24 hours or until court appearance |
| Drug Offenses | Possession, distribution, paraphernalia | High | 24–72 hours or until bond/court appearance |
| Assault / Domestic Violence | Simple assault, domestic battery | High | 48–72 hours or until bond/court order |
| Property Crimes | Larceny, burglary, breaking & entering | Moderate | 24–72 hours or until bond/court appearance |
| Failure to Appear | Missed court dates | High | Until next available court date |
| Outstanding Warrants | Bench warrants, unresolved charges | High | Varies; often until court appearance |
| Felony (Pre-Trial) | Aggravated assault, drug trafficking | Moderate | Held pre-trial; sentenced inmates transferred to state facility |

Parole, Release & Reentry Resources in Harnett County
The North Carolina Post-Release Supervision and Parole Commission oversees parole decisions for eligible state-sentenced offenders. Individuals in Harnett County can access reentry support and resources through state agencies and local community-based programs.
| Program / Resource | Description | Who It Serves | Contact / Access |
|---|---|---|---|
| North Carolina Board of Parole | Reviews and makes decisions regarding parole and post-release supervision for state offenders. | State-sentenced offenders | NC Post-Release Supervision and Parole Commission |
| Good Time / Sentence Reduction | Allows eligible inmates to earn sentence reduction through good behavior and participation in programs. | Incarcerated individuals | NC Sentence Credit Info |
| Parole Supervision (Harnett County) | Supervision, monitoring, and support for parolees returning to Harnett County. | Parolees in Harnett County | Lillington Community Corrections Office: 310 W Cornelius Harnett Blvd, Lillington, NC 27546 Phone: (910) 893-2286 |
| Reentry Housing | Assistance finding transitional or supportive housing upon release. | Returning citizens | NC Reentry Housing Resources |
| Employment Assistance | Help with job placement, skills training, and employment readiness after release. | Formerly incarcerated | NCWorks Harnett County 1301 W. Front St, Lillington, NC (910) 893-2191 |
| Benefits Restoration | Support restoring Medicaid, Social Security, or other public benefits. | Returning citizens | NC Justice Center—Benefits Guide |
| VINE Victim Notification | Victim notification system for updates on offender custody status and parole events. | Victims, concerned community | NC SAVAN/VINE Phone: (877) 627-2826 |

Harnett County Facility Directory
Harnett County has two correctional facilities: a county jail and a regional state facility. These include the Harnett County Detention Center and the Harnett Correctional Institution.
| Facility Name | Type | Location | Capacity | Population | Security Level |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Harnett County Detention Center | County Jail | 175 Bain St, Lillington, NC | 300 | ~250 | Medium/Maximum |
| Harnett Correctional Institution | Regional Facility | 1210 E. McNeil St, Lillington, NC | 988 | ~970 | Medium/Minimum |
